Metodo SWbemDateTime.GetFileTime
Il metodo GetFileTime dell'oggetto SWbemDateTime converte un valore di data e ora nel formato CIM DATETIME nel formato FILETIME.
Se il parametro è impostato su TRUE, il valore restituito rappresenta un'ora locale per il client. In caso contrario, il valore restituito è un'ora UTC (Coordinated Universal Time). Una struttura FILETIMEDATETIME è un valore a 64 bit che rappresenta il numero di unità da 100 nanosecondi dall'inizio del 1° gennaio 1601. Strumentazione gestione Windows (WMI) considera i valori FILETIME come rappresentazioni di stringa di numeri senza segno a 64 bit.
Per una spiegazione di questa sintassi, vedere Document Conventions per l'API di scripting.
Sintassi
vDate = .GetFileTime( _
[ ByVal bIsLocaL ] _
)
Parametri
-
bIsLocaL [in, facoltativo]
-
Indica se il valore restituito viene interpretato come ora locale. La proprietà UTC contiene quindi l'ora locale convertita nell'offset UTC (Coordinated Universal Times) corretto. Se il valore è FALSE, il valore viene interpretato come UTC con un offset zero (0).
Valore restituito
Data e ora nel formato FILETIME .
Codici di errore
Dopo aver completato il metodo GetFileTime , l'oggetto Err può contenere il codice di errore nell'elenco seguente.
-
wbemErrFailed - 2147749889 (0x80041001)
-
La chiamata non è riuscita.
Commenti
VT_DATE e i valori FILETIME non possono contenere campi con caratteri jolly.
Il metodo GetFileTime ha esito negativo (wbemErrFailed) se una delle proprietà seguenti è FALSE:
- YearSpecified
- MonthSpecified
- DaySpecified
- HoursSpecified
- MinutesSpecified
- SecondsSpecified
- MicrosecondsSpecified
- UTCSpecified
In caso di restituzione riuscita da SetFileTime, tutte queste proprietà sono impostate su TRUE.
Esempio
Per esempi di utilizzo dell'oggetto SWbemDateTime per convertire i valori CIM DATETIME in e dal formato FILETIME o dal formato VT_DATE , vedere Attività WMI: Date e ore. Per una descrizione del formato CIM DATETIME , vedere Formato di data e ora.
Requisiti
Requisito | Valore |
---|---|
Client minimo supportato |
Windows Vista |
Server minimo supportato |
Windows Server 2008 |
Intestazione |
|
Libreria dei tipi |
|
DLL |
|
CLSID |
CLSID_SWbemDateTime |
IID |
IID_ISWbemDateTime |